Transaction 83fc08accc54e0caf1120cfb7cc2517038349051c32fdf47cc54a4c674618ac8
1 Input
1 Output
-
83fc08accc54e0caf1120cfb7cc2517038349051c32fdf47cc54a4c674618ac8:0
- value
- 2927867
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c80811b7619a109ef5eac519e3b800baa71b50a OP_EQUALVERIFY OP_CHECKSIG
- address
- 17yWJDYAjGVF54wui6gHFdydZtAgupBJ8j